Foreign sales amount to US$24 billion

In 2010, Vale was the largest Brazilian exporter, with sales on foreign markets of US$24 billion, 122.07% up on the previous year. According to figures from the Ministry of Development, Industry and Foreign Trade, Vale’s exports were 32% higher than those of the second-ranking company, Petrobrás.

As a result of this growth, Vale accounted for 11.91% of total Brazilian exports last year and its exports even exceeded the country’s trade surplus of US$20.278 billion. It is expected that Vale will retain the number one ranking in 2011.
